目录
?
3 filecoin开发网使用
o 3.1 辅助资源 o 3.2 使用
? 3.2.1 接入filecoin开发网络 ? 3.2.2 获取Mock FIL用于测试 ? 3.2.3 矿工操作
? 3.2.3.1 存储矿工 ? 3.2.3.2 检索矿工 ? 3.2.3.3 修复矿工
? 3.2.4 客户操作
3.2.4.1 存储客户 ? 3.2.4.2 检索客户 3.2.5 filecoin合约
?
?
?
3.2.5.1 文件合约 ? 3.2.5.2 智能合约
3.2.6 单机运行多个filecoin节点
?
3.2.6.1 修改资源目录和服务端口的方式 ? 3.2.6.2 容器部署方式
?
3 filecoin开发网络使用
3.1 辅助资源
?
Filecoin状态: https://stats.kittyhawk.wtf
? o 网络
存储实时价格 FIL/GB/Month ? 当前存储容量 GB ? 当前网络利用率 ? 检索平均价格
? 激活节点以及分布图 ? 存储平均价格曲线 ? best tipset
o 存储矿工
?
存储矿工数量变化曲线 ? 存储矿工共识结果 ? 近30天的矿工top图
o 检索矿工
?
平均检索价格 ? 平均检索时间 ? 平均检索容量
o FIL指数
? ? ? ? ? ?
?
流通FIL及抵押FIL变化曲线图 FIL地址总数
FIL总抵押数及对应存储空间 FIL总数上升曲线图 FIL区块奖励下降曲线图
Filecoin区块浏览器: http://user.kittyhawk.wtf:8000
?
o Chain信息 o BestBlock信息 o Actor合约信息 ?
获取FIL用于抵押或支付:http://user.kittyhawk.wtf:9797
?
o 获取Mock FIL代币 ?
Dashboard: http://user.kittyhawk.wtf:8010
?
o Network概览,最新区块信息 o 区块浏览器链接 ?
Genesis File: http://user.kittyhawk.wtf:8020/genesis.car
?
o 创始文件,用于初始化filecoin资源 ?
Prometheus Endpoint: http://user.kittyhawk.wtf:9082/metrics
?
o 一些技术指标,比如内存、进程、线程等 ?
Connected Nodes PeerID's: http://user.kittyhawk.wtf:9082/nodes
?
o 连接的节点信息
3.2 使用
3.2.1 接入filecoin开发网络
?
初始化filecoin资源目录
如果之前有运行过filecoin,想重新开始,需要删除filecoin资源,同时重新初始化是需要重新花时间同步开发网区块信息的。
rm -rf ~/.filecoin
初始化资源目录,使用--devnet-user表示连接至开发网
waynewyang:Downloads waynewyang$ go-filecoin init --devnet-user --genesisfile=http://user.kittyhawk.wtf:8020/genesis.car initializing filecoin node at ~/.filecoin waynewyang:Downloads waynewyang$ ?
启动filecoin进程,接入开发网
go-filecoin daemon
//如果开发者,需要接入nightly devnet,请设置环境变量后启动filecoin env FIL_USE_SMALL_SECTORS=true go-filecoin daemon
?
检查连接性
go-filecoin swarm peers 查看已经连接的节点
waynewyang:filecoin waynewyang$ go-filecoin swarm peers
/ip4/115.238.154.84/tcp/19109/ipfs/Qmb6ZYi7GLFAje3UekGZ2LZymck7RVHKSK
b1bhPzzPTQkm